I feed Totally Ferret, 8 in 1, ZuPreem and I also mix a little Iams kitten food in there.
It is recommened to offer several differnt brands. Ferrets can be picky eaters and if a manufacturer changes 1 ingredient, the ferret will not eat. My one ferret will not eat the Zupreem, and the other will not eat the 8 in 1. I use to put Marshalls in there as well, but it makes their poo smell really bad.
I get mine at PetCo.
